Came here for a birthday event and was looking forward to the experience based on the reviews.

Coming in before the “party” started it was beautiful. We had ordered some drinks but were told that it would be a while since the bartenders were backed up. Assuming they meant it would come during our meal we went ahead and ordered it. Big mistake, we never ended up getting our drinks until we asked to just cancel them when we got our bill cause they never came. At that point it just felt that they sent it over just to show that they gave it.

The service was less than subpar. The servers barely came by and everyone got their dishes at different times, including one of my party guests receiving it as we requested our bill. Same with being given wrong dishes even when the server wrote it down.

Ordered the signature dish: castelmagno and the parmigiana. We never received the parmigiana however my castelmagno was amazing. They gave us the Zucchini blossons instead telling us it was what we ordered.

When asked the server about our drinks he said he didn’t know and that he’s been drinking all night already, the music became louder as the night went on and everyone was just drinking water and waiting for their correct dishes, when we got our bill the server yelled at my friend when she told him to take the drinks off the bill since we never received them.

The servers were unprofessional and drinking on the job, and more focused on partying than getting our orders through and honestly don’t think I would come back again.

Wish it was a better experience.

Our New Year’s Eve experience at Bagatelle was shockingly bad and completely unacceptable.

We made a same-day reservation via Resy for 8 people, received both email and text confirmation, and arrived on time for our NYE dinner. Upon arrival, we were abruptly told that our reservation had been “cancelled” and that there was no room for us—despite our confirmed booking.

What made the situation exponentially worse was the manager’s behavior. Instead of attempting to resolve the issue or even speaking to us respectfully, he became hostile and screamed at our group, repeatedly saying he “didn’t have food for us” and that it was “not his problem.” There was no apology, no explanation, and absolutely no effort to help—just outright aggression and dismissal.

Our group has traveled extensively and dined at top restaurants all over the world. Mistakes happen in hospitality, especially on a busy night like NYE—but how they are handled is everything. This was, without question, the worst dining experience I’ve ever had, purely due to the staff’s behavior and lack of professionalism.

For a restaurant that markets itself as upscale and world-class, this level of service is inexcusable. I would strongly caution anyone considering Bagatelle for an important night or special occasion.
